Approaches for Online Healing and Skill-building
Client-centered therapy emphasizes empathetic listening and meeting people where they are, creating space for clients to explore feelings and personal goals while the therapist follows the client’s lead.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) focuses on identifying and changing thought and behavior patterns that contribute to distress, offering concrete strategies for anxiety, stress, and mood challenges.Choosing the right approach is a collaborative process. Lorinda works with each client to assess needs, try techniques, and refine the plan so the methods align with personal goals, values, and what feels most helpful in practice.
Online therapy with video calls, phone sessions, live chat, or text-based messaging provides flexibility for people juggling family, work, or geographic distance. These formats allow regular, consistent contact and make it easier to use skills in real-life moments, practice communication strategies between sessions, and maintain continuity of care while adapting to each person’s schedule.
